## Nightly Backfill Scheduler — quick facts

The Pellam scheduler kicks off backfills at 02:00 local depot time. If a run stalls, don't re-trigger manually — it dedupes by date and will silently no-op. Instead, mark the run failed in the console and let the retry loop pick it up. When filing issues, include the token shown below.

pipeline stamp: htk9_b3279b371

Handover note for the board, from Director Ines Marlowe to Director Tobias Crane, covering the Fennick & Rowe retail pilot. Status: eight of ten Hallowby-area stores are live on the Cartwheel checkout units, with returns processing still in staged rollout. Open items include the shrinkage baseline review and the renewal decision due next month. Tobias now owns all chain-side communications. A confidential note on the related commercial plans follows below.

board note of fahif-yahog: Gross margin on Wenath came in at 10 percent against a plan of 5 percent. Only 3 of the 100 pilot accounts renewed Wenath, so a churn review is set for July 15.

**Ticket #4812 — Transcode workers dropping connections**

Hey plugin folks — we're seeing intermittent connection failures on the Framewright transcoding farm since the weekend. Workers in the Opalbay cluster keep timing out when claiming jobs, and a few plugins are retrying in a tight loop, which makes it worse. Please add backoff in your job-claim logic. If you need to verify job state directly, point your plugin at the farm's metadata store.

primary connection of yagep-kahip = redis://giliel_svc:zYiKsLL2PLpfPL@db-348f.xolmarsys.corp:5432/fenwyn

Every release of the Kerbline parking-garage occupancy feed is built in a sealed pipeline and signed before publication. As a contractor, you should never trust an artifact pulled from outside the Ashfold registry, even if checksums match — provenance attestations are the only accepted proof of origin. Each attestation records the source revision, builder identity, and dependency snapshot. To verify a running feed instance, compare its embedded provenance record against the registry entry. The current verified build token appears below.

pipeline stamp: htk6_35e0c9